一、使用 SpringMVC 框架時,如果 HTTP 請求資源返回的是中文字符串,則會出現亂碼。原因如下: SpringMVC 框架可以使用 @RequestBody 和 @ResponseBody 兩個注解,分別完成請求到對象和對象到響應的轉換,底層這種靈活的響應機制,就是Spring3.X ...
今天在后台取出數據傳給前端時展示的時候,發現中文亂碼,在后台打斷點 debug 調試發現返回時顯示還是正常的,但是到前端發現亂碼,由此知道是在返回的過程中發生了亂碼問題。 項目環境是 SSM,模板引擎使用的是 freemarker,在 Spring MVC 中配置的編碼為 UTF ,后來查找資料發現了問題所在,因為在 controller 中返回 json 用了 ResponseBody,而 S ...
2020-08-22 09:48 0 557 推薦指數:
一、使用 SpringMVC 框架時,如果 HTTP 請求資源返回的是中文字符串,則會出現亂碼。原因如下: SpringMVC 框架可以使用 @RequestBody 和 @ResponseBody 兩個注解,分別完成請求到對象和對象到響應的轉換,底層這種靈活的響應機制,就是Spring3.X ...
該問題是由於字符串的自體類型設置問題,AD默認是【stroke】,我們點擊【TrueType】即可正常顯示。PS:AD18搞啥呢,默認顯示輸入內容不行嗎,找半天!!! ...
://baike.baidu.com/view/4517800.htm 方法1、字符串編碼為UTF-8的,一個中文字符占三個字節: ...
問題: 后台代碼如下: 前台代碼如下: 發現前台顯示的json數據中的中文為???。亂碼問題。 原因: Spring中解析字符串的轉換器默認編碼居然是ISO-8859-1 如下所示: 解決方法: 方法一,使用(produces ...
最近關於中文顯示亂碼的貼子比較多,所以也做了個總結: 可以參考一下楊濤濤版主的《各種亂碼問題匯總》http://topic.csdn.net/u/20071124/08/3b7eae69-ed1d-4a77-8895-9930bf3601af.html MySQL字符 ...
中文亂碼的問題,在開發過程中難免會遇到,而在配置好編碼之后,不管是數據庫,還是其他地方都配置好統一UTF-8編碼之后,后端從數據庫取出數據傳回前端,還會亂碼,這里以ssm框架為例,因為是我自己遇到的,可能是Controoler層的路由配置中的問題,如下圖: 如果需要傳中文到前端,必須在 ...
XMLHttpRequest 默認是用UTF-8 傳遞數據。當服務端和客戶端以及數據庫統一使用UTF-8編碼可以有效的避免亂碼問題。如果服務端設置了正確的Content-Type Response Header以及編碼信息,那么XmlHttpRequest也可以正確工作。可是當使用 ...
Spring MVC3返回JSON數據中文亂碼問題解決 查了下網上的一些資料,感覺比較復雜,這里,我這幾使用兩種很簡單的辦法解決了中文亂碼問題。 Spring版本:3.2.2.RELEASE Jackson JSON版本:2.1.3 解決思路:Controller的方法中直 ...